Hostels today are no longer just budget accommodations—they’ve evolved into stylish, social, and experience-driven spaces. Many top-rated hostels now rival boutique hotels in design, while still offering affordability and community.
If you’re looking for the best hostels worldwide, the top picks are usually based on guest reviews, atmosphere, cleanliness, and location.
What Makes a Hostel Top Rated

Highly rated hostels consistently deliver more than just a place to sleep.
Key qualities include:
- Cleanliness and comfort
- Strong social atmosphere
- Central or scenic location
- Friendly, helpful staff
- Unique design or experience
Modern hostels often include rooftop bars, coworking spaces, and organized events—making them attractive even for non-budget travelers. (Faroway)
Top Rated Hostels Around the World
Here are some globally recognized hostels based on rankings, reviews, and travel expert lists:
Los Patios – Medellín, Colombia
Known for its modern design and rooftop spaces, often ranked among the best worldwide. (All World Travel Blog)
Generator Barcelona – Spain
A design-focused hostel combining style with affordability in a prime city location. (Faroway)
The RoadHouse Prague – Czech Republic
Famous for its social atmosphere and community-driven experience. (All World Travel Blog)
Dalur HI Hostel – Reykjavik, Iceland
Highly rated for cleanliness and comfort in a unique destination. (All World Travel Blog)
Onefam Sants – Barcelona, Spain
Popular for solo travelers due to its strong social environment. (All World Travel Blog)
Longboard Paradise Surf Club – Rio de Janeiro, Brazil
Recognized for sustainability and eco-friendly operations. (global.hostelworld.com)
Popular Hostel Chains and Brands

Some hostel brands consistently rank highly across multiple cities.
Generator Hostels
Known for stylish interiors and vibrant social scenes across Europe.
Wombat’s City Hostels
Award-winning chain with strong ratings for comfort and service. (wombats-hostels.com)
MEININGER Hotels/Hostels
Hybrid concept combining hotel privacy with hostel affordability.
These chains often provide more predictable quality across locations.
Comparison of Hostel Types
| Hostel Type | Best For | Experience |
|---|---|---|
| Party hostels | Social travelers | Lively and energetic |
| Boutique hostels | Comfort seekers | Stylish and quieter |
| Eco hostels | Conscious travelers | Sustainable focus |
| Digital nomad hostels | Remote workers | Work-friendly spaces |
Choosing the right type matters as much as choosing the location.

How to Choose the Best Hostel for You
Different travelers prioritize different things.
For solo travelers
Look for hostels with organized activities and shared spaces.
For couples or privacy
Choose hostels offering private rooms.
For remote work
Check Wi-Fi quality and coworking areas.
For budget travel
Compare total value, not just price per night.
Quick Tip
Read recent reviews—not just overall ratings. Hostel quality can change quickly depending on management and maintenance.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is the best hostel in the world?
There isn’t a single answer, but places like Los Patios and Generator Barcelona are often ranked among the top globally.
Are hostels safe for travelers?
Yes, highly rated hostels typically have good security and staff presence, though it’s always important to take basic precautions.
How much do top hostels cost?
Prices vary widely, but many top hostels offer dorm beds from $10 to $40 per night depending on location.
Are hostels only for young travelers?
No, hostels attract a wide range of ages, including solo travelers, couples, and digital nomads.
Do top-rated hostels offer private rooms?
Yes, many modern hostels provide private rooms alongside shared dorms.
